Mashtal, Baghdad, Iraq

Overview

Mashtal is an energetic district in Baghdad offering visitors a glimpse into daily Iraqi life. The area features a mix of traditional markets, residential streets, and riverside spots, making it popular with locals and a growing number of travelers. While not as touristy as central Baghdad, Mashtal presents authentic culture and lively community scenes.

Best Time to Visit

October-April for mild weather and fewer dust storms.

Local Tips

Bring cash, as many places do not accept credit cards. Haggling is common in markets, and bottled water is recommended. Expect heavy traffic during rush hours.

Cultural Etiquette

Dress modestly; women should cover arms and legs. Tipping in restaurants (10%) is appreciated but not mandatory. Greet elders respectfully and avoid public displays of affection.

Safety Warnings

Exercise caution after dark, especially in the Industrial Quarter. Beware of pickpockets in crowded markets. Check latest travel advisories, as security situations can change quickly.

Hidden Gems

Explore riverside gardens along the Tigris, visit small art studios in Rasafa Riverside, and try fresh samoon bread from traditional bakeries in Al-Mashtal Center.
